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ea Ingredients: Your Flavor Arsenal

Here’s what you need to whip up this liquid gold. Don’t worry, it’s all stuff you can easily find in your pantry or local grocery store:

  • 1 cup water: The base of our tea, pure and simple.
  • 1 tea bag (black tea or chai): Black tea gives a classic, robust flavor, while chai adds an extra layer of spice. Your choice!
  • ½–1 cup milk: Whole milk, almond milk, oat milk – whatever floats your boat. Adjust the amount to your preferred level of creaminess.
  • ½ tsp cinnamon: Ground cinnamon is your best bet for easy blending.
  • ½ tsp vanilla extract: Pure vanilla extract is key for that authentic vanilla flavor. Imitation vanilla? No way, José!
  • Sweetener (optional): Honey, sugar, maple syrup – sweeten to your liking.

These ingredients are the foundation of a perfect cup. It’s the vanilla and cinnamon that really make the difference!

Step-by-Step: Mastering the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ea Technique

Ready to get cooking? Follow these simple steps and you’ll be sipping on a delicious cup of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ea in no time:

  1. Boil 1 cup of water.: Use a kettle or a saucepan. Get that water nice and bubbly!
  2. Add the tea bag and steep for 3–5 minutes.: Let the tea bag infuse its flavor into the water. The longer you steep, the stronger the tea.
  3. Mix in cinnamon.: Stir in the cinnamon until it’s fully dissolved. This is where the magic starts to happen.
  4. Pour in milk and heat without boiling.: Gently heat the milk and tea mixture on the stovetop. Don’t let it boil, or you’ll risk scalding the milk.
  5. Add vanilla extract and sweetener.: Stir in the vanilla extract and your sweetener of choice. Taste and adjust as needed.
  6. Strain and serve warm.: Strain the tea through a fine-mesh sieve to remove any tea leaves or cinnamon clumps. Pour into your favorite mug and enjoy!

These steps ensure the best possible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ea every time. Because it’s so easy, you’ll be making it every day!

Pro Tips for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ea Perfection

Want to take your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ea to the next level? Here are a few pro tips to help you become a true tea master:

  • Use high-quality ingredients: The better the ingredients, the better the flavor. Splurge on good-quality tea, cinnamon, and vanilla extract.
  • Don’t over-steep the tea: Over-steeping can make the tea bitter. Stick to the recommended steeping time.
  • Heat the milk gently: Overheating the milk can change its flavor and texture. Heat it slowly and gently over low heat.
  • Adjust the sweetness to your liking: Some people prefer their tea sweeter than others. Adjust the amount of sweetener to your personal taste.
  • Experiment with different types of milk: Try using almond milk, oat milk, or soy milk for a vegan-friendly option.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even the best cooks make mistakes. Here are a few common pitfalls to avoid when making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ea:

  • Using old or stale spices: Spices lose their flavor over time. Make sure your cinnamon is fresh and fragrant.
  • Overheating the milk: Overheating the milk can cause it to scald and develop an unpleasant flavor.
  • Adding too much sweetener: Too much sweetener can mask the other flavors in the tea. Start with a small amount and add more as needed.
  • Forgetting to strain the tea: Straining the tea removes any tea leaves or cinnamon clumps, resulting in a smoother, more enjoyable drink.

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ea Variations: Spice It Up!

Feeling adventurous? Here are a few fun variations to try:

  • Spiced Chai Latte: Use chai tea instead of black tea for an extra layer of spice.
  • Iced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ea: Chill the tea and serve it over ice for a refreshing summer treat.
  •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ea with Honey: Use honey instead of sugar for a more natural sweetener.
  •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ea with Brown Sugar: Brown sugar adds a rich, molasses-like flavor.
  •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ea with a Dash of Nutmeg: A pinch of nutmeg adds a warm, cozy flavor.

If you prefer a stronger cinnamon flavor, add a cinnamon stick while heating the milk. You can also try different types of tea, like green tea or rooibos, for a unique twist.

Storage Instructions

Made too much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ea? No problem! Here’s how to store it:

  • Refrigerate: Store leftover tea in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ours.
  • Reheat: Gently reheat the tea on the stovetop or in the microwave.
  • Don’t freeze: Freezing the tea can change its texture and flavor.

Homemade Vanilla Cinnamon Milk Tea

Enjoy a warm and comforting cup of homemade vanilla cinnamon milk tea. This simple recipe is perfect for a cozy afternoon or a relaxing evening.
Prep Time 2 minutes
Cook Time 8 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Servings: 1 serving
Course: Beverage
Cuisine: Indian
Calories: 150

Ingredients
  

Ingredients
  • 1 cup water
  • 1 tea bag black tea or chai
  • 0.5-1 cup milk
  • 0.5 tsp cinnamon
  • 0.5 tsp vanilla extract
  • Sweetener optional

Method
 

  1. Boil 1 cup of water.
  2. Add the tea bag and steep for 3–5 minutes.
  3. Mix in cinnamon.
  4. Pour in milk and heat without boiling.
  5. Add vanilla extract and sweetener.
  6. Strain and serve warm.

Notes

Adjust the amount of cinnamon and vanilla to your liking. For a richer flavor, use whole milk or add a splash of cream.
